For decades, Peter Schickele has kept audiences rolling in the aisles with his rib-tickling presentations of the alleged music of P.D.Q. Bach, classical music's answer to the Marx Brothers. This special December 2005 performance of P.D.Q.'s greatest hits celebrates 40 years of this uniquely appealing act. Includes Schleptet in Eb major, Iphigenia in Brooklyn, Unbegun Symphony, Fuga Meshuga, The Seasonings, and New Horizons in Music Appreciation. Extras include Unbegun Symphony with theme identification, Odden und Enden (rounds), KUHT interview with Peter Schickele, and more.
